FJ Universe RSI macd
- Uzmanlar
- Frantisek Juris
- Sürüm: 1.0
- Etkinleştirmeler: 5
Genel Bakış
FJUNIVERSE RSI MACDON EA, RSI (Göreceli Güç Endeksi) ve MACD'yi (Hareketli Ortalama Yakınsama Iraksaması) temel sinyal motoru olarak kullanan MetaTrader 5 için tam otomatik bir Uzman Danışmandır. Herhangi bir işlem açılmadan önce, EA aynı anda on adede kadar yapılandırılabilir RSI ve MACD koşulunu değerlendirir. Tüm koşulların aynı anda geçmesi gerekir. Bu yaklaşım yanlış girişleri azaltır ve hesapta açılan her pozisyonun kalitesini artırır. Bu EA, orijinal FJ UNIVERSE HFTT Expert Advisor'ın genişletilmiş versiyonudur...
EA; sekiz işlem stratejisi modu, Dolar Maliyet Ortalaması (DCA) motoru, Otomatik Lot Kurtarma sistemi ve her sinyal koşulunun canlı durumunu gösteren gerçek zamanlı grafik filtresi gösterge paneli içermektedir.
Sinyal Motoru — RSI ve MACD Koşulları
Her işlem girişi FJU EYE Filtresi tarafından kontrol edilir. Aşağıdaki koşullar mevcuttur ve her biri bağımsız olarak etkinleştirilebilir veya devre dışı bırakılabilir:
- RSI seviye filtresi: yalnızca RSI bir eşik değerin altında veya üzerinde olduğunda giriş yap
- RSI yükseliş uyuşmazlığı: fiyat daha düşük bir dip yaparken RSI daha yüksek bir dip yapar
- RSI düşüş uyuşmazlığı: fiyat daha yüksek bir zirve yaparken RSI daha düşük bir zirve yapar
- MACD histogramı yükselen: histogram değeri önceki bardan daha yüksek
- MACD histogramı düşen: histogram değeri önceki bardan daha düşük
- MACD geçiş sayısı minimumu: son sıfır çizgisi geçişinden bu yana sinyal hattı geçişlerinin minimum sayısını gerektir
- MACD geçiş sayısı maksimumu: aşırı salınımı filtrelemek için geçiş sayısını sınırla
- FJU yükseliş momentumu: RSI yükseliş uyuşmazlığı, MACD histogramının negatiften pozitife dönmesi ve yapılandırılmış aralıkta geçiş sayısının birleşimi
- FJU düşüş momentumu: RSI düşüş uyuşmazlığı, MACD histogramının pozitiften negatife dönmesi ve yapılandırılmış aralıkta geçiş sayısının birleşimi
- İşlem yönü: tüm aktif koşullar geçtiğinde uygulanan LONG veya SHORT
RSI göstergesi periyodu, MACD hızlı periyodu, yavaş periyot, sinyal periyodu ve geçiş sayısı aralığı giriş parametreleri aracılığıyla yapılandırılabilir.
Grafik Filtresi Gösterge Paneli
EA çalışırken, grafiğin sağ üst köşesinde her aktif koşulun canlı durumunu gösteren bir kaplama görünür. Yeşil değer koşulun geçtiğini gösterir. Kırmızı geçmediğini gösterir. RSI ve MACD göstergesi, strateji testi sırasında da dahil olmak üzere trader'ın temel sinyalleri her zaman görebilmesi için EA başlangıcında otomatik olarak grafiğe eklenir.
İşlem Stratejileri
| Strateji | Açıklama |
|---|---|
| CLASSIC | EYE Filtresi tarafından belirlenen yönde (LONG veya SHORT) sinyal başına bir işlem açar. Yalnızca bu EA için hesapta mevcut pozisyon olmadığında yeni işlem açılır. |
| CLASSIC_EXTREME | Mevcut açık pozisyonlardan bağımsız olarak her yeni bar sinyalinde EYE Filtresi yönünde işlem açar. Aynı yönde birden fazla pozisyon zamanla birikebilir. |
| TREND | Yönü son kapalı mum gövdesinden belirler. Kapanış açılışın üzerindeyse (yükseliş mumu) long açar. Kapanış açılışın altındaysa (düşüş mumu) short açar. Aynı anda yalnızca bir pozisyon açık. |
| TREND_EXTREME | TREND ile aynı mum yönü mantığı ancak önceki pozisyonun kapanmasını beklemeden her bar sinyalinde yeni pozisyon açar. Pozisyonlar mum yönünde birikir. |
| REVERSE | TREND'in tersi. Son mum yükseliş kapandığında short açar. Düşüş kapandığında long açar. Aynı anda yalnızca bir pozisyon açık. |
| REVERSE_EXTREME | REVERSE ile aynı ters mum mantığı ancak öncekinin kapanmasını beklemeden her sinyalde pozisyon biriktirir. |
| CLASSIC_EXTREME_SMART | EYE Filtresi yönünde pozisyon biriktirir, ancak yalnızca mevcut fiyat o yöndeki tüm mevcut pozisyonların ortalama açılış fiyatından daha iyi olduğunda. Long'larda ask mevcut long ortalamasında veya altında olmalı. Short'larda bid mevcut short ortalamasında veya üzerinde olmalı. |
| CLASSIC_EXTREME_SMART_PLUS | EYE Filtresi yönünde pozisyon biriktirir, ancak yalnızca mevcut fiyat o yöndeki tüm açık pozisyonlar arasındaki en iyi (long'lar için en yüksek, short'lar için en düşük) bireysel giriş fiyatından daha iyi olduğunda. CLASSIC_EXTREME_SMART'tan daha katı giriş filtresi. |
Dolar Maliyet Ortalaması (DCA)
DCA etkinleştirildiğinde, EA piyasa başlangıç işlemine karşı hareket ettikçe ek pozisyonlar açar. Pozisyon sepeti, birleşik kar alma seviyesine ulaşıldığında birlikte kapatılır. DCA dizileri sırasında isteğe bağlı olarak stop loss aktif kalabilir. Her ek pozisyonun lot büyüklüğü yapılandırılmış işlem boyutu ayarlarından hesaplanır.
Otomatik Lot Kurtarma
Önceki işlemler net kayıpla sonuçlandığında, Otomatik Lot Kurtarma sistemi açığı kapatmak için bir sonraki işlemde daha büyük lot büyüklüğü hesaplar. İki mod mevcuttur:
- Sihirli numaraya göre geçmiş işlemlerden: bu EA'ya ait son N işlemin gerçek kapalı kar/zarar değerini okur ve kurtarma için gereken kesin lot hesaplar
- Öz sermaye ve bakiye düşüşünden: canlı öz sermayeyi bakiyeye karşı izler ve fark yapılandırılan eşiği aştığında kurtarma sıfırlamasını tetikler
Kar Al ve Zarar Durdur Boyutlandırması
Dört boyutlandırma formatı mevcuttur:
- PERCENT_OF_BALANCE: fiyatın sıfıra tam hareketi hesap bakiyesinin yapılandırılmış yüzdesine (LONG durumunda -100%) mal olacak şekilde lot büyüklüğü hesaplanır. Pratikte bu çok küçük bir pozisyon üretir, bu nedenle tipik bir TP veya SL isabeti bu yüzde kaybının yalnızca küçük bir bölümünü temsil eder.
- PERCENT_OF_EQUITY: PERCENT_OF_BALANCE ile aynı hesaplama ancak bakiye yerine canlı öz sermaye kullanır, bu nedenle lot büyüklüğü öz sermaye değişimine göre dinamik olarak ayarlanır.
- CURRENCY_AMOUNT: hesap para biriminde sabit tutar
- LOT: doğrudan lot büyüklüğü girişi
Öz Sermaye Hedefi Otomatik Çıkış
Belirli bir öz sermaye değeri yapılandırılabilir. Hesap bu seviyeye ulaştığında, EA tüm açık pozisyonları kapatır ve kendini grafikten otomatik olarak kaldırır. Bu, challenge hesaplarda veya yönetilen hesaplarda kar hedeflerini çalıştırmak için kullanışlıdır.
FJ UNIVERSE: Giriş Parametreleri
Strateji ayarları
| Parametre | Varsayılan | Açıklama |
|---|---|---|
| RSIM_TP_PERC | 1.0 | Kar alma boyutu, costFormat tarafından yorumlanır |
| RSIM_SL_PERC | 1.0 | Zarar durdurma boyutu, costFormat tarafından yorumlanır |
| costOfSingleOrder | 1.0 | Temel işlem boyutu |
| costFormat | PERCENT_OF_BALANCE | Maliyetin ölçüm şekli: LOT, CURRENCY_AMOUNT, PERCENT_OF_BALANCE, PERCENT_OF_EQUITY |
| tradingStrategy | CLASSIC | Sekiz strateji modundan biri |
DCA ve kurtarma ayarları
| Parametre | Varsayılan | Açıklama |
|---|---|---|
| useDCA | false | Dolar Maliyet Ortalamasını etkinleştir |
| activateSLWithDCA | false | DCA dizileri sırasında stop loss'u aktif tut |
| useAutoLotRecoveryByFJU | FROM_PAST_TRADES_BY_MAGIC_NUMBER | Lot kurtarma yöntemi: geçmiş işlemler, öz sermaye düşüşü veya devre dışı |
| recoveryRangeForPastTrades | 100 | Lot kurtarma hesaplamasına dahil edilen geçmiş işlem sayısı |
| additionalPercentageToRecovery | 10 | Hesaplanan kurtarma lotunun üzerine eklenen ekstra yüzde |
| closeAllTradesOnEquityHigherThen | 0 | Öz sermaye bu değere ulaştığında tüm işlemleri otomatik kapat. Devre dışı bırakmak için 0. |
| useEquityManagerForAutoLotRecovery | true | Öz sermaye tabanlı pozisyon sıfırlama korumasını etkinleştir |
| lastCycleOfRSIM | false | Bunu son kurtarma döngüsü olarak işaretle. Kurtarma tamamlandıktan sonra yeni giriş açılmaz. |
EA genel ayarları
| Parametre | Varsayılan | Açıklama |
|---|---|---|
| orderComment | FJUNIVERSE.COM | RSIM | TRADE | Her emir biletine eklenen yorum |
| magicNumber | 260306 | EA tanımlayıcısı. Sembol ve grafik örneği başına benzersiz olmalıdır. |
| useFillingPolicy | true | Aracı kurum doldurma politikasını otomatik algıla (IOC, FOK veya RETURN) |
RSI ve MACD sinyal koşulları
| Parametre | Varsayılan | Açıklama |
|---|---|---|
| EYE_RSI_BELOW | 100.0 | Yalnızca RSI bu değerde veya altında olduğunda giriş yap. Yok saymak için 100. |
| EYE_RSI_ABOVE | 0.0 | Yalnızca RSI bu değerde veya üzerinde olduğunda giriş yap. Yok saymak için 0. |
| EYE_RSI_BULL_DIV | false | İşlem açmak için RSI yükseliş uyuşmazlığı gerektir |
| EYE_RSI_BEAR_DIV | false | İşlem açmak için RSI düşüş uyuşmazlığı gerektir |
| EYE_MACD_RISING | false | MACD histogramının yükseliyor olmasını gerektir |
| EYE_MACD_FALLING | false | MACD histogramının düşüyor olmasını gerektir |
| EYE_MACD_X_ABOVE | 0 | Son sıfır çizgisi geçişinden bu yana MACD sinyal hattı geçiş sayısı minimumu. Yok saymak için 0. |
| EYE_MACD_X_BELOW | 99 | MACD geçiş sayısı maksimumu. Yok saymak için 99. |
| EYE_BULL_MOMENTUM | false | FJU yükseliş momentumu gerektir: RSI uyuşmazlığı, MACD histogram dönüşü ve aralıkta geçiş sayısının birleşimi |
| EYE_BEAR_MOMENTUM | false | FJU düşüş momentumu gerektir: yukarıdaki koşulun düşüş karşılığı |
| EYE_OPEN_SIGNAL | LONG_TRADE | Tüm koşullar geçtiğinde yön: LONG_TRADE veya SHORT_TRADE |
RSI ve MACD gösterge ayarları
| Parametre | Varsayılan | Açıklama |
|---|---|---|
| EYE_RSI_LEN | 14 | RSI periyot uzunluğu |
| EYE_MACD_FAST | 12 | MACD hızlı EMA periyodu |
| EYE_MACD_SLOW | 26 | MACD yavaş EMA periyodu |
| EYE_MACD_SIG | 9 | MACD sinyal düzleştirme periyodu |
| EYE_MACD_MIN_X | 2 | Momentum sinyali için minimum geçiş sayısı |
| EYE_MACD_MAX_X | 3 | Momentum sinyali için maksimum geçiş sayısı |
| EYE_SHOW_INDICATOR | true | EA başlangıcında RSI ve MACD görsel göstergesini grafiğe ekle |
Kurulum
- FJUNIVERSE_RSI_MACDON.ex5'i MQL5 Experts klasörüne yerleştirin
- MetaTrader 5'i yeniden başlatın veya Gezgini yenileyin
- EA'yı bir grafiğe sürükleyin ve AutoTrading'i etkinleştirin
EA tüm semboller ve zaman dilimlerinde çalışır. RSI ve MACD göstergesi başlangıçta arka planda otomatik olarak grafiğe eklenir ve EA kaldırıldığında otomatik olarak silinir.
Bildirimler (isteğe bağlı)
EA, webhook aracılığıyla Discord'a ve Bot API aracılığıyla Telegram'a işlem raporları gönderebilir. Her ikisi de isteğe bağlıdır. Bunları kullanmak için MetaTrader 5'te Araçlar, Seçenekler, Uzman Danışmanlar, Listelenen URL'ler için WebRequest'e izin ver bölümünde ilgili URL'lere izin verin. Bildirimlere gerek yoksa webhook ve token alanlarını boş bırakın.
Notlar
- Tüm sinyal koşulları AND-kapılıdır. EA bir işlem açmadan önce etkinleştirilen her koşulun aynı anda geçmesi gerekir. Bir koşulu devre dışı bırakmak onu kontrolden tamamen kaldırır. Varsayılan değeri yoksay olarak ayarlanmış bir koşul (örneğin RSI_BELOW = 100 veya RSI_ABOVE = 0) değiştirilmediği sürece hiçbir etkisi yoktur.
- Aynı anda birden fazla sembol veya zaman diliminde EA çalıştırırken sihirli numara grafik örneği başına benzersiz olmalıdır.
- Ek belgeler ve set dosyası örnekleri için ürün yorumları bölümüne bakın.
Risk Feragatnamesi:
İşlem yapmak önemli riskler içerir ve geçmiş performans gelecekteki sonuçların göstergesi değildir. FJ UNIVERSE EXPERT ADVISORS, hem potansiyel karları hem de kayıpları artıran yüksek kaldıraçlı yüksek frekanslı işlem stratejisi kullanır. Piyasa oynaklığı, ekonomik değişiklikler ve öngörülemeyen olaylar performansı etkileyebilir. Kar garantisi yoktur ve yatırdığınız sermayenin bir kısmını veya tamamını kaybedebilirsiniz. Bu EA'yı kullanmadan önce her zaman kendi araştırmanızı yapın, risk toleransınızı değerlendirin ve bir finansal danışmana danışmayı düşünün. Gösterilen performans benim hesabımı yansıtmaktadır, ancak hesap büyüklüğü, aracı kurum koşulları veya işlem zamanlamasındaki farklılıklar nedeniyle sonuçlarınız farklılık gösterebilir. Bu EA'nın kullanıcılarının uğradığı kayıplardan sorumlu değilim.
